The Simple Ingredients
Gather these staples. The quality here makes a big difference, so use the best you have on hand.
- 1 thick slice of sourdough bread (or your favorite crusty bread)
- 1/3 cup whole milk ricotta cheese
- 1-2 tablespoons honey, for drizzling
- 1 tablespoon roasted salted almonds, chopped
- 1 tablespoon shelled pistachios, chopped
- A pinch of flaky sea salt (like Maldon)
- A few cracks of black pepper (trust me!)
- Optional: Fresh thyme or a sprinkle of cinnamon
Let’s Get Cooking! (The Step-by-Step)
Ready? Set your timer. We’re done in 10 minutes flat. This process is impossible to mess up.
- Toast your bread. Pop your sourdough slice in the toaster, toaster oven, or a hot skillet. We want it golden and crisp. That crunch is key.
- Spread the ricotta. While the toast is hot, slather on the ricotta cheese. Let it get a little warm and creamy from the bread.
- Add the protein punch. Scatter the chopped almonds and pistachios all over the creamy ricotta layer. For another high-protein treat that satisfies a sweet tooth, check out this easy protein cookie dough recipe.
- Drizzle and finish. Here’s the magic. Drizzle that honey all over everything. Then, finish with a pinch of flaky salt and a crack of black pepper. The pepper makes the honey taste even sweeter.
- Serve immediately. Dig in right away while the toast is crisp and the ricotta is soft.

Make This Recipe Your Own (Quick Swaps)
No pistachios? No problem. Use what’s in your pantry. This recipe is made for swaps.
Try walnuts or pecans instead of almonds. Use maple syrup or agave if you’re out of honey. A sprinkle of everything bagel seasoning adds a savory twist. Get creative!
For a different cheese, try whipped cottage cheese or mascarpone. Both are delicious and creamy.

F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S
Can I make this gluten-free?
Absolutely! Just use your favorite gluten-free bread. The rest of the ingredients are naturally gluten-free.
Is whole milk ricotta really better?
Yes, for flavor and creaminess. The full-fat version has a richer taste and spreads beautifully. It makes the snack more satisfying.
Why add black pepper?
It sounds weird, but it’s a game-changer. The pepper adds a tiny, warm kick. It makes the honey taste deeper and more complex. Just try it once!
